10-Oct-2025

DSC for DGFT | Secure Digital Signature for Foreign Trade

Your DGFT applications could be rejected without this! It's a Digital Signature for Foreign Trade.

Every day, countless import-export applications are delayed or rejected by DGFT. Let's be honest—DGFT filings can be difficult. One wrong click, one missing signature, and your import-export plans are messed up!

But top exporters never worry about this. Why? Because they use a Digital Signature Certificate (DSC) to get their applications approved quickly and securely.

Whether you're applying for an IEC or submitting a license for restricted goods, having a DSC for DGFT is essential.

Don't take risks with your DGFT filings!Buy Capricorn DSC for DGFT online today!

What is Digital Signature Certificate for DGFT?


A Digital Signature for DGFT is an electronic tool that allows you to securely sign and submit applications, documents, and e-filings. It ensures your identity is authenticated and authorizes your transactions on Directorate General of Foreign Trade (DGFT) portal in India. This means every submission on DGFT portal related to imports, exports, and foreign trade needs a DSC for DGFT.

Which DSC is required for Import Export?


You must know which DSC is required for Import Export. Not all Digital Signature Certificates are the same.

Class 3 DSC for DGFT

- Required for high-value or restricted trade licenses.

- Offers enhanced security for sensitive applications.

- Mandatory for your DGFT filings involving restricted goods or high-risk export-import categories.

What is the Validity of DGFT DSC?


A Digital Signature for DGFT comes with a fixed validity period. After which, it must be renewed to continue filing applications smoothly.

Typical DSC for DGFT validity:

- DSCs are valid for 1, 2, or 3 years. You can decide the validity of DGFT DSC according to your preference. Always buy Digital Signature from trusted DSC providers in India, like Capricorn CA.

Benefits of DSC for DGFT


A DSC for DGFT is mandatory for a reason. There are several advantages of using a Digital Signature for DGFT:

1. Legal Recognition: Ensures your applications are officially accepted by DGFT.

2. Time-Saving: Approvals for IEC and licenses are processed faster.

3. Paperless Convenience: File all DGFT applications online without physical paperwork.

4. Enhanced Security: Protects your documents from tampering or fraud.

5. Multiple Filings: Use the same DSC for all your import-export applications.

6. Reduced Errors: Minimizes mistakes that can lead to rejections or delays.

7. Cost-Effective: Avoids repeated trips, courier costs, and delays in business operations.

DGFT DSC Uses


1. IEC (Import Export Code) Application

- Filing a new IEC application or modifying an existing IEC online may require a DGFT DSC for authentication.

- DSC ensures that the application is legally valid and the identity of the applicant is verified.

2. License Applications

- For restricted goods export/import, DGFT issues licenses that need to be applied for online. A DSC is required to digitally sign these applications.

3. Online Transactions & Declarations

- Certain export/import declarations, bond filings, or licence submissions need a DSC to be accepted by the system.

4. Document Authentication

- Sign all trade-related documents with a DSC for DGFT online to prevent rejection.

DGFT Login


Here is the step-by-step process for DGFT login:

Step 1: Visit the DGFT Portal
Go to DGFT website.

Step 2: Click on “Login”
Find the login option on the homepage on the top right corner.

Step 3: Enter Credentials:
- Username (your email ID)

- Password

Step 4: Enter Captcha
Type the security code shown on the screen.

Step 5: Click “Login”
You will be logged in to your DGFT account.

Now that you are successfully logged in to your DGFT account, you can start with your DGFT filings and submissions.

But to start with that you need to register your DSC for DGFT online first!

DGFT DSC Documents Required


You need a few documents before you know how to Register DSC in DGFT portal. Here are he documents:

DGFT DSC Documents Required for Proprietorship Firm


The following documents are needed for proprietors:

1. Applicant's passport-size photo

2. PAN card of the applicant

3. Aadhaar card for identity proof

4. Active mobile number and email ID

5. GST registration certificate (all 3 pages)

6. IEC copy

DGFT DSC Documents Required for Partnership Firm


The following documents are needed for partnership firms:

1. Applicant's photo, PAN, and Aadhaar

2. Active mobile number and email ID

3. GST registration certificate (3 pages)

4. Authorization letter (as per prescribed format)

5. Partnership deed copy

6. IEC copy

DGFT DSC Documents Required for LLP Firm


The following documents are needed for LLPs:

1. Applicant's photo, PAN, and Aadhaar

2. Active mobile number and email ID

3. LLP PAN card

4. GST registration certificate (3 pages)

5. Authorization letter (as per format)

6. List of partners on company letterhead (signed and stamped)

7. IEC copy

DGFT DSC Documents Required for Private Limited or Limited company


The following documents are needed for registered companies:

1. Applicant's photo, PAN, and Aadhaar

2. Active mobile number and email ID

3. Company PAN card

4. GST registration certificate (3 pages)

5. Authorization letter (as per format)

6. List of directors on company letterhead (signed and stamped)

7. IEC copy

How to Register DSC in DGFT Portal?


Now the next step is to register your DSC in DGFT portal:

Step 1: DGFT Login
Go to the DGFT portal and login using your credentials.

Step 2: Go to ‘My Dashboard'
From the left panel, click on ‘View and Register Digital Signature'.

Step 3: Register DSC
Go to Register New DSC option

Step 4: Enter Details
Fill in the User details

Step 5: Select DSC certificate on DGFT
Choose your Digital Signature Certificate from the list and click on register.

Now you know how to register DSC in DGFT portal. After this process, your DSC registration on DGFT portal is completed.

How to get DSC for DGFT?


Want to know how to get DSC for DGFT? Here are all the steps required for the same:

1. Choose a Certified Provider:
Pick a government approved Certifying Authority (CA) such as Capricorn CA.

2. Select Your DSC Type:
Choose a Class 3 DSC for DGFT.

3. Verify with Mobile OTP:
Enter the OTP sent to your registered mobile number for verification.

4. Fill Out the eKYC Form:
Complete your basic details like name, address, and business information.

5. Confirm via Email:
Verify your email address by clicking the link sent to your inbox.

6. Upload Documents:
Submit ID proof, address proof, and business documents as required.

7. Complete Video Verification:
Record a short video to confirm your identity as per CCA guidelines.

8. Submit Your Application:
Review your details and submit the form online.

9. Wait for Approval:
The Certifying Authority will verify your information and approve your DSC.

10. Make the Payment:
Pay the DSC fee securely through the available payment options.

11. eSign the Agreement:
Complete the e-signing process to authorize your DSC issuance.

12. Set Up Your USB Token:
Once approved, install your DSC on a secure USB token.

13. Download DGFT DSC:
Finally, download and activate your DSC in the token. It will be ready to use on the DGFT portal.

DGFT DSC Price


What is the cost of DGFT DSC?

The cost of a Digital Signature Certificate or DSC for DGFT depends on its type, validity, and issuing provider.
It's best to buy your DSC from a DGFT-approved Certifying Authority (CA) like Capricorn CA. It ensures seamless registration and faster approval.

Want to buy Digital Signature for DGFT online? Get Capricorn DSC now!

Conclusion


You have learned everything about a Digital Signature for DGFT now! DSC for DGFT validity, DGFT DSC Uses, DGFT Login, DGFT DSC price, how to get DSC for DGFT, DGFT DSC Documents required, How to Register DSC in DGFT portal, and more.

If you're into import or export, you can't compromise with a DGFT DSC . It makes your online filings safe, quick, and fully verified. This gives your trade the credibility it deserves.

Make your foreign trade effortless with a DSC for DGFT. Get your Capricorn DSC today and experience seamless DGFT compliance like never before!

whatsapp